Web9 feb. 2024 · Mars, also known as the Red Planet, should be around 33.9million miles (54.6m kilometres) away from Earth at its closest. At its furthest Mars is 250 million miles away from our planet. Mars is around 141.6m miles (227.9m kilometres) away from the Sun. The distance … Web18 feb. 2016 · The distance depends on where Earth and Mars are in their respective orbits. The minimum distance from the Earth to Mars is about 54.6 million kilometers, or 54.6 billion meters. The farthest apart they can be is about 401 million km, or 401 billion meters. The average distance is about 225 million km, or 225 billion meters.
